Long revered for his inspiring music, worldwide philanthropic efforts and the power of optimism, Michael Franti continues to offer opportunities for gratitude, solidarity and celebrating how we get through the greatest ups and downs of our lives with our body, mind and soul still in one piece with upcoming album Follow Your Heart, set for release June 3rd via Thirty Tigers. “One thing I learned these last couple of years is that people need people,” shares Franti. “I wrote many songs about connection, resilience and finding the light, even in the midst of all the crazy. Somewhere in there we find resilience, and I hope Follow Your Heart gives fans the courage to continue looking for and holding onto that perseverance.”

On Friday (22nd), Franti released the title track ‘Follow Your Heart‘, debuting the acoustic premiere via Instagram Live from his boutique retreat hotel Soulshine Bali in Ubud, sharing, “I wrote this with a guy named Greg Hvnsen who is an incredible writer and producer, and the song is about how following your heart during the pandemic seemed to be the answer to every question.



“The answer to so many questions was to listen to what my heart was saying, even though I couldn’t do a lot of the things I enjoy because we had to be isolated,” Franti elaborated. “We couldn’t travel, tour or make music the way we did before, but there were still a lot of things in my life that needed to be taken care of: relationships, health, this business as an entrepreneur (Soulshine Bali), and ‘follow your heart’ became the answer to so many questions for me.”

Opening with upbeat, rhythmic palm-muted acoustic strumming, ‘Follow Your Heart’ encourages listeners to trust their intuition, follow their dreams and seek out their deepest desires, all while keeping hope alive:

Friday’s release follows ‘Brighter Day‘, an anthemic call to endure life’s hardships, and ‘Good Day For A Good Day‘, which marked the band’s 10th Top 25 AAA hit.

Work Hard And Be Nice was released in 2020, which included lead single ‘I Got You’, the Franti & Spearhead’s first Billboard No. 1 in nearly 10 years, and was also featured on NPR’s mid-year and end-year ‘Heavy Rotation: Public Radio’s Most Popular Songs of 2020’, sharing, “Michael Franti’s infectious groove is unmistakable. From the opening chords to the percolating rhythm, it’s easy to get caught up in the positivity he exudes.”

Michael Franti & Spearhead will be kicking off the Follow Your Heart UK tour in February 2023. They will play St. Luke’s Music & Arts Venue, Glasgow (Feb 7th), Manchester Academy 2 (Feb 8th) and London’s O2 Shepherd’s Bush Empire (Feb 10th).
